学会使用jQuery库进行快速开发

红尘紫陌 2024-11-15T23:02:12+08:00
0 0 198

介绍

在Web开发中,快速、高效地进行开发是非常关键的。jQuery库是一个非常流行的JavaScript库,它简化了JavaScript编程,并提供了一组强大而易于使用的API,可以帮助开发者更快速地操作HTML文档、处理事件、执行动画等。本篇博客将向大家介绍如何学会使用jQuery库进行快速开发。

安装jQuery库

首先,我们需要下载并安装jQuery库。你可以在官方网站 https://jquery.com/ 上下载最新版本的jQuery库,或者直接引用CDN地址。在你的HTML文件中引入jQuery库文件,如下所示:

<script src="https://cdn.jsdelivr.net/jquery/3.5.1/jquery.min.js"></script>

选择器

使用jQuery库,我们可以使用选择器来选择HTML文档中的元素。jQuery库支持多种选择器,包括标签选择器、类选择器、ID选择器等。例如,使用类选择器选择所有class为"example"的元素:

$(".example")

使用ID选择器选择ID为"example"的元素:

$("#example")

DOM操作

使用jQuery库,我们可以方便地操作HTML文档中的元素。比如,通过选择器选择一个元素,并修改它的内容:

$("#example").text("Hello, jQuery!");

或者,通过选择器选择一组元素,并添加一个CSS类:

$(".example").addClass("highlight");

事件处理

jQuery库还提供了丰富的事件处理方法,可以让我们更便捷地处理事件。比如,给一个按钮添加点击事件:

$("#myButton").click(function() {
    // 在这里写逻辑代码
});

或者,在鼠标悬停在一个元素上时,改变其背景颜色:

$(".example").hover(function() {
    $(this).css("background-color", "yellow");
}, function() {
    $(this).css("background-color", "white");
});

动画效果

jQuery库还有强大的动画效果支持,可以让我们轻松地添加动画效果,比如淡入淡出、滑动、缩放等。以下是一个实现淡入淡出效果的示例:

$(".example").fadeIn(1000);
$(".example").fadeOut(1000);

AJAX

使用jQuery库的AJAX功能,我们可以轻松地进行异步数据交互。比如发送一个GET请求:

$.get("url", function(data) {
    // 处理返回的数据
});

或者发送一个POST请求:

$.post("url", { key1: "value1", key2: "value2" }, function(data) {
    // 处理返回的数据
});

插件

jQuery库还支持许多第三方插件,可以进一步扩展其功能。你可以在官方网站的插件页面上找到各种插件,并按照文档的说明进行安装和使用。

总结

通过学会使用jQuery库进行快速开发,我们可以更加高效地操作HTML文档、处理事件、执行动画等。本篇博客介绍了jQuery库的一些基础知识和常用功能,希望可以帮助大家提高开发效率。如果你对jQuery库感兴趣,不妨去官方网站了解更多信息,并实践一些例子,提升自己的技能。

相似文章

    评论 (0)